The consultant will be responsible for facilitating the development of the MJHMP through a collaborative process with Coconino County, municipal representatives, stakeholders, and the public. The Scope of work shall contain the following, but not be limited to this list as negotiated with the successful vendor: 1. Project Management and Coordination i. Coordinate project planning and regular status updates with Coconino County’s Emergency Management Department. ii. Establish and lead a multi-jurisdictional planning team to oversee plan development and maintain communication with all participating jurisdictions in accordance with FEMA direction and requirements. iii. Develop a detailed project timeline, including milestones for all phases of plan development. 2. Data Collection and Risk Assessment i. Collect and analyze existing data on natural and human-made hazards relevant to Coconino County. ii. Work with local stakeholders to assess vulnerabilities, potential impacts, and exposure for all identified hazards, incorporating GIS mapping for spatial analysis. iii. Update hazard profiles and risk assessments for each jurisdiction, ensuring an inclusive approach that considers the unique risks faced by different areas and populations within the County...
